Output 904da32010f9d075a76a0dcbdd64da8b0b5237c63689c180b4c17725f6cdaa08:16

value
40577619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10779f0b65a21bc95b5149f798e916ff4f184312 OP_EQUAL
address
33C633XhmZrjrA1dpj3w9LFDroa79G13wy
transaction
904da32010f9d075a76a0dcbdd64da8b0b5237c63689c180b4c17725f6cdaa08
spent
true